Odyssey : My Life as a Controversial Evolutionary Psychologist
Other Available Formats
Overview
This book tells two intertwined stories. The first is the author's autobiography-how he became a controversial race researcher. The second describes the rise, fall, and rebirth of the Darwinian perspective in the behavioral sciences. Rushton's life story forms one strand in the entire tapestry of the history of the last 150 years of behavior genetics, psychometrics, and human sociobiology.
